Itinerary:
Glacier National Park is one of the gems in America's National Parks system. The plan is to spend about a week exploring some of the hikes around Logan Pass and Many Glacier. We would car camp in St Mary for the week. From St Mary, it is about a 29km drive to Logan Pass while Many Glacier is about 34km away.

Here are some of the possibilities:

Logan Pass:
Hidden Lake- 9.6km return/376m gain (Wildflower meadows; glaciers; jagged peaks)
The Garden Wall- 18.9km return/244m gain (Wildflower meadows; jagged peaks; wildlife viewing)

Many Glacier:
Cracker Lake- 17.9km return/347m gain (Impressive lake beneath towering cliffs);
Grinnell Glacier- 17.6km return/518m gain ( A close-up look at the glacier)
Iceberg Lake- 15km return/372m gain (The name says it all)
Ptarmigan Tunnel- 17.9km return/706m gain ( Hike to an alpine lake then up to a 180ft tunnel through a rockwall)
Swift Current Pass- 24.3 km return/872m gain (Some of the best views in the park)

This trip is best suited to fit/experienced hikers. We will need to keep a brisk pace on the longer hikes and also to allow time for exploring. Also, in order to keep costs to a minimum, all participants will be expected to share a tent. Please indicate your preferences when signing up.
